RTC Appraisers Assailed: The General Accounting Office said its analysis indicates that 69% of the Resolution Trust Corp.’s review appraisers don’t appear to be adequately qualified for their positions because they lack appraisal experience. The GAO faulted the thrift bailout agency for not having adequate hiring standards or criteria for the positions. According to the GAO, the RTC so far has ordered more than 100,100 appraisals for real estate under its control. The congressional watchdog agency said highly qualified appraisers are needed to protect the government’s interest in valuing and selling assets.
